L'atelier Fabriquer une interface disquette projet

Reprise du message précédent
salutpour les disks de martos sur philips je crois qu'il fallait désactiver le 2eme drive en appuyant sur "control" au boot
les disquettes ne respecte pas tous le format "standard" c'est pour ca que certaine sont illisible et peuvent te retournez des noms de fichiers irréel ca permettait de gagner de la place
sur fdd normal 2 zone de fat (table des fichiers 1 d'utilisation , l'autre une sauvegarde)
si le secteur de boot est perso et que tu met dans diskmanager tu as des chance de rien y voir !!!
Citation :
Citation:
... pourquoi pas une petite série
Peut-être début septembre
... pourquoi pas une petite série

Peut-être début septembre

ca m'interresse si controlleur = WD37C65 ??
le schema de MSXPRO est il aussi erroné ??? ou est ce le meme (TDC600)

TURBO-R FS-A1ST 512/128ko MSX2+ NMS 8250 F4 /Fix Audio /Ram 1/4Mb VDP9958 VRAM 192ko 2FDD SANYO WAVY PHC35J MSX2 NMS 8280 Ram 4Mb VDP9938 VRAM 192ko 2FDD NMS 8250 128/128ko 2FDD VG8235/39 128/128ko 1FDD SONY HB-F700D MSX1 MC810 32/16k VG 8020 64k HB75F 64k HX-22 64k RS232/ CX5M 32k HB501F EXT : My Exp 4X/[b] MegaFlashSCC 512ko/BERT R2/BEER CF/SUNRISE 2CF/FUNRICE V2.01/MAXIOL/MEGASCSI HDD-CD/SDMSX 1SD/FMPAC SRAM/NMS1205+1160/RS 232 Harukaze/GR8NET/DOS2/ HOMER V2 RAM512ko/Floppy Pack/MAXduino/ROM1664/FM Pak /GR8NET /AMIGA/ PC/ RaspB Pi(B) / ARDUINO
Elle a l'air bien sympathique cette interface. Avec une RTC en option, ça serait impec ! Elle pourrait même tenir dans un boitier de cartouche ordinaire sans trop d'effort. Un lecteur suffit.
Si tu ne peux pas la remettre en anglais, fais-moi signe !
La plupart des Megaroms de Martos ne fonctionnent que sur HB-700.
Essaie celles-ci : MEGAROMS4MSX-DOS.zip
Elles se lancent sous DOS. Elles devraient Fonctionner si tu as au moins un mapper de type interne de 256Ko. Il faut aussi que le système ait sélectionné ce Mapper en tant que RAM principale. Edité par GDX Le 05/08/2015 à 08h53
metalgear2 :
Un truc que j'avais complétement zapper
... le bios est dans la langue de Gustavo, en Argentin 




Si tu ne peux pas la remettre en anglais, fais-moi signe !
metalgear2 :
Là, j'essai de trouver un jeu MSX2 du style NEMESIS2. Toutes les versions que j'ai sont de Martos. J'arrive jamais a faire quelque chose de bien avec disquettes a lui.
La plupart des Megaroms de Martos ne fonctionnent que sur HB-700.
Essaie celles-ci : MEGAROMS4MSX-DOS.zip
Elles se lancent sous DOS. Elles devraient Fonctionner si tu as au moins un mapper de type interne de 256Ko. Il faut aussi que le système ait sélectionné ce Mapper en tant que RAM principale. Edité par GDX Le 05/08/2015 à 08h53

Je me doute bien que c'est un probléme de FAT, mais je m'dis que le fichier DSK est fait a partir d'une vrai disquette, donc il doit bien exister un logiciel qui fait l'inverse.
Ou alors, les fichiers DSK ne sont que pour les émulateur.
Je s'avais même pas que sur le site de MSXPRO, il y a avait le schéma. J'y vais trés raremement ce site
Ou alors, les fichiers DSK ne sont que pour les émulateur.
Je s'avais même pas que sur le site de MSXPRO, il y a avait le schéma. J'y vais trés raremement ce site

le piége dans Disk Manager est qu'il faut répondre NON au message : the backup copy of FAT ......etc
sinon la FAT est automatiquement reconstruite et comme les jeux ou ce message apparait n'ont pas de FAT car ils démarrent par le secteur de BOOT on imagine les dégats
sinon la FAT est automatiquement reconstruite et comme les jeux ou ce message apparait n'ont pas de FAT car ils démarrent par le secteur de BOOT on imagine les dégats

Oui, Jipe à raison.
J'ai déjà reconstruits des disquettes avec des .DSK qui avaient un listing de fichiers des plus étranges. Mais, ça à fonctionné une fois remis sur une vraie disquette.
J'ai déjà reconstruits des disquettes avec des .DSK qui avaient un listing de fichiers des plus étranges. Mais, ça à fonctionné une fois remis sur une vraie disquette.

ouais j'avais commencer a le refaire sur diptrace si ca t'interresse call me
le schema de MSXPRO

le proto sur DipTrace

mais j'ai pas finaliser
le schema de MSXPRO

le proto sur DipTrace

mais j'ai pas finaliser
TURBO-R FS-A1ST 512/128ko MSX2+ NMS 8250 F4 /Fix Audio /Ram 1/4Mb VDP9958 VRAM 192ko 2FDD SANYO WAVY PHC35J MSX2 NMS 8280 Ram 4Mb VDP9938 VRAM 192ko 2FDD NMS 8250 128/128ko 2FDD VG8235/39 128/128ko 1FDD SONY HB-F700D MSX1 MC810 32/16k VG 8020 64k HB75F 64k HX-22 64k RS232/ CX5M 32k HB501F EXT : My Exp 4X/[b] MegaFlashSCC 512ko/BERT R2/BEER CF/SUNRISE 2CF/FUNRICE V2.01/MAXIOL/MEGASCSI HDD-CD/SDMSX 1SD/FMPAC SRAM/NMS1205+1160/RS 232 Harukaze/GR8NET/DOS2/ HOMER V2 RAM512ko/Floppy Pack/MAXduino/ROM1664/FM Pak /GR8NET /AMIGA/ PC/ RaspB Pi(B) / ARDUINO

GDX :
Si tu ne peux pas la remettre en anglais, fais-moi signe !
Merci GDX, mais en faite, en éditant la ROM, il n'y avait que trois lignes a mettre en anglais. J'en ai profité pour la renomer en ver 1.1 pour faire la différence.

Citation :
La plupart des Megaroms de Martos ne fonctionnent que sur HB-700.
Ca, je savais pas

Citation :
Essaie celles-ci : MEGAROMS4MSX-DOS.zip
Merci, je test ce soir.
Bastion Rebel :
Voilà pourquoi je vais trés peu sur ce site. Il a posté le schéma sans vérifier car c'est le même que Gustavo, il y a aussi l'erreur le schema de MSXPRO

Merci pour le fichier Diptrace


ouais malheureusement beaucoup de schéma sont erroné ou incomplet sur son site (MSXPRO)
y as de grosse erreur ?? sur son schéma !!
pour la rom ouais pas grand chose a modifier !!
y as de grosse erreur ?? sur son schéma !!
pour la rom ouais pas grand chose a modifier !!

TURBO-R FS-A1ST 512/128ko MSX2+ NMS 8250 F4 /Fix Audio /Ram 1/4Mb VDP9958 VRAM 192ko 2FDD SANYO WAVY PHC35J MSX2 NMS 8280 Ram 4Mb VDP9938 VRAM 192ko 2FDD NMS 8250 128/128ko 2FDD VG8235/39 128/128ko 1FDD SONY HB-F700D MSX1 MC810 32/16k VG 8020 64k HB75F 64k HX-22 64k RS232/ CX5M 32k HB501F EXT : My Exp 4X/[b] MegaFlashSCC 512ko/BERT R2/BEER CF/SUNRISE 2CF/FUNRICE V2.01/MAXIOL/MEGASCSI HDD-CD/SDMSX 1SD/FMPAC SRAM/NMS1205+1160/RS 232 Harukaze/GR8NET/DOS2/ HOMER V2 RAM512ko/Floppy Pack/MAXduino/ROM1664/FM Pak /GR8NET /AMIGA/ PC/ RaspB Pi(B) / ARDUINO
Je me répète mais si tu peux ajouter un emplacement pour mettre une RTC, ça apporterai un grand plus pour les MSX1. Ne plus devoir entrer l'heure et la date au démarrage : le pied. Jipé disait que c'est assez simple à faire. Peut-être qu'il faut prévoir un switch MSX1/MSX2 ?
En tout cas, je connais quelqu'un à qui ça intéresse (surtout si les contacts sont dorés et il a bien raison).
En tout cas, je connais quelqu'un à qui ça intéresse (surtout si les contacts sont dorés et il a bien raison).

Bastion Rebel :
y as de grosse erreur ?? sur son schéma !!
J'essais de poster le schéma ce soir.
GDX :
Je me répète mais si tu peux ajouter un emplacement pour mettre une RTC, ça apporterai un grand plus pour les MSX1. Ne plus devoir entrer l'heure et la date au démarrage : le pied. Jipé disait que c'est assez simple à faire. Peut-être qu'il faut prévoir un switch MSX1/MSX2 ?
En tout cas, je connais quelqu'un à qui ça intéresse (surtout si les contacts sont dorés et il a bien raison).
En tout cas, je connais quelqu'un à qui ça intéresse (surtout si les contacts sont dorés et il a bien raison).
J'avais bien compris ton idée qui est trés intéressante, mais il y a pas mal de composant pour un RTC. Je l'ais fait sur mon CX5M et ça prend un peu de place. Ou alors, il faut choisir un boitier du style MusicModule.
Aprés, il faut aussi penser à la ROM qui gére le RTC, ça commence a faire du monde tout ça ...

http://www.msxvillage.fr/forum/topic.php?id=2071&pt=6#m48620
http://www.msxvillage.fr/forum/topic.php?id=2071&pt=7#m48682
Le 74138 et le 7404 prennent beaucoup moins de place en SOIC / SO8 et sont moins chers (frais de port aussi). Pareil pour les résistances, des SMD 1206. Le gains de place est appréciable puisque l'on gagne presque 50% de place sur le PCB et 100% l'autre face.
Je pense que c'est la Disk-ROM qui gère ça donc si cette ROM n'est pas trop exotique, ça devrait aller. Edité par GDX Le 05/08/2015 à 17h24
metalgear2 :
Aprés, il faut aussi penser à la ROM qui gére le RTC, ça commence a faire du monde tout ça ...

Je pense que c'est la Disk-ROM qui gère ça donc si cette ROM n'est pas trop exotique, ça devrait aller. Edité par GDX Le 05/08/2015 à 17h24

C'est vrai que si tu part sur une version CMS, le probléme est résolu.
Je pense pas que c'est la diskROM, sur mon CX5M modifier en MSX2, j'ai pas de lecteur et le RTC est là. Je me souviens d'en avoir parlé avec Jipe, la gestion du RTC se trouve dans la MAINROM ou SUBROM, je me souviens plus
Je me rappel que tu avais déjà soulever la question : http://www.msxvillage.fr/forum/topic.php?id=2071&pt=8#m48714
Je pense pas que c'est la diskROM, sur mon CX5M modifier en MSX2, j'ai pas de lecteur et le RTC est là. Je me souviens d'en avoir parlé avec Jipe, la gestion du RTC se trouve dans la MAINROM ou SUBROM, je me souviens plus

Je me rappel que tu avais déjà soulever la question : http://www.msxvillage.fr/forum/topic.php?id=2071&pt=8#m48714

Citation :
Je pense que c'est la Disk-ROM qui gère ça donc si cette ROM n'est pas trop exotique, ça devrait aller.
il faut bien remplir la 29F040 !!! mais pour utiliser les 512ko faut un mapper NON !! donc composant en plus !! pour l'adressage jusqu'à A18 !!
avec une rom 27F512 soit 64ko et que la ROMDISK est de 16ko reste 48ko pour ta RTC !!

le probleme en CMS c'est qu'a un moment il faut passer de l'autre coté !!! Edité par Bastion Rebel Le 05/08/2015 à 17h43
TURBO-R FS-A1ST 512/128ko MSX2+ NMS 8250 F4 /Fix Audio /Ram 1/4Mb VDP9958 VRAM 192ko 2FDD SANYO WAVY PHC35J MSX2 NMS 8280 Ram 4Mb VDP9938 VRAM 192ko 2FDD NMS 8250 128/128ko 2FDD VG8235/39 128/128ko 1FDD SONY HB-F700D MSX1 MC810 32/16k VG 8020 64k HB75F 64k HX-22 64k RS232/ CX5M 32k HB501F EXT : My Exp 4X/[b] MegaFlashSCC 512ko/BERT R2/BEER CF/SUNRISE 2CF/FUNRICE V2.01/MAXIOL/MEGASCSI HDD-CD/SDMSX 1SD/FMPAC SRAM/NMS1205+1160/RS 232 Harukaze/GR8NET/DOS2/ HOMER V2 RAM512ko/Floppy Pack/MAXduino/ROM1664/FM Pak /GR8NET /AMIGA/ PC/ RaspB Pi(B) / ARDUINO
metalgear2 :
Je pense pas que c'est la diskROM, sur mon CX5M modifier en MSX2, j'ai pas de lecteur et le RTC est là. Je me souviens d'en avoir parlé avec Jipe, la gestion du RTC se trouve dans la MAINROM ou SUBROM, je me souviens plus

En y réfléchissant, c'est sans doute la Sub-ROM quand le MSX est sous Basic et la Disk-ROM quand il est sous DOS donc pas de ROM à ajouter. Faudrait vérifier ça pour en être sûr. C'est possible aussi que le DOS accède à la RTC directement.
Edit : J'ai vérifié vite fait, pas d'accès direct dans le DOS donc il passe par la Sub-Rom. Edité par GDX Le 06/08/2015 à 16h30

Bonjour,
J'ai fait aussi un essai hier soir avec un MSX sans le RTC.
- Avec un module RTC + l'interface FDD sur ce MSX, il ne garde pas la date ou l'heure, donc pas de gestion RTC dans la DiskROM.
- J'ai fait un autre essai sur mon proto MSX, avec le module RTC + l'interface FDD, il garde bien la date et l'heure.
Résultat, enfin je pense et comme tu le dis GDX, il faut une SubROM qui gére le RTC.
GDX :
Edit : J'ai vérifié vite fait, pas d'accès direct dans le DOS donc il passe par la Sub-Rom.
J'ai fait aussi un essai hier soir avec un MSX sans le RTC.
- Avec un module RTC + l'interface FDD sur ce MSX, il ne garde pas la date ou l'heure, donc pas de gestion RTC dans la DiskROM.
- J'ai fait un autre essai sur mon proto MSX, avec le module RTC + l'interface FDD, il garde bien la date et l'heure.
Résultat, enfin je pense et comme tu le dis GDX, il faut une SubROM qui gére le RTC.
Répondre
Vous n'êtes pas autorisé à écrire dans cette catégorie